Best to-do list app?
What's some of the better to-do list apps out there? I've got a bunch of things on my plate from day to day. While I get everything important done there's always something I think of a couple days later that I needed to get taken care of at some point.
Features I'd be looking for. 1. Tasks that can be set up to occur daily 2. Rolling over of not completed tasks to the following day. 3. Easy inputting and checking off of tasks. If it's too much of a hassle I'll end up not doing it. Sure I could buy a planner of some kind but that just means I have to carry something else around with me. Anything that you guys are using?
